Taylor Swift's 'Actually Romantic': A Playful Jab Wrapped in Love

Taylor Swift's New Track: Whispers of Rivalry?

Taylor Swift's latest album, The Life of a Showgirl, has ignited a whirlwind of speculation following the release of her track "Actually Romantic." Fans are delving deep, trying to piece together the puzzle behind its lyrics, which many believe might be directed at fellow pop star Charli XCX.

A Love Letter with a Twist

Diving into the song's detailed narrative, Swift revealed during a cinema screening that "Actually Romantic" serves as "a love letter to someone who hates you." This clever juxtaposition of affection and disdain sets the stage for an intriguing exploration of modern celebrity relationships.

"It's flattering," Swift quipped, subtly crafting an aura of rivalry as she thanked the subject of her song for their relentless attention.

Swift vs. Charli: An Evolving Narrative

Fans quickly identified parallels between Swift's track and Charli XCX's song "Sympathy is a Knife," which features lyrics hinting at resentment towards a woman—presumably Swift—who once captured the spotlight. The accusations of a beef resurfacing have sparked debates among fans and critics alike. Swift's characteristic blend of sharp wit and playful sarcasm is woven throughout the song, compelling listeners to wonder whether she intends to provoke XCX or simply engages in artistic bravado.

The Heart of the Matter: Understanding the Lyrics

“It sounded nasty but it feels like you're flirting with me,” Swift sings, inviting listeners to explore the dualities of negative emotions and unexpected admiration. Fan Reactions: A Mixed Bag

At club nights dedicated to celebrating Swift's music, fans have shared their perspectives on the song. Many felt deeply connected to its themes, with one fan stating, "It's universal, we've all had that feeling." Yet, others expressed concerns about the ethical implications of targeting fellow artists.

  • Anya, 24, from Brighton, resonated with the song's themes of rivalry and insecurity.
  • Contrastingly, Tanya, 27, a huge Charli XCX fan, questioned Swift's feminist ethos in 'taking shots at her.'

Decoding Swift's Lyrics: The Internet's Playground

As with previous albums, the speculation taps into the cultural zeitgeist surrounding Swift's work. Beyond the apparent jabs, the underlying messages challenge us to consider how artists navigate friendships, rivalries, and the constant scrutiny of their lives.

Among the other tracks generating buzz, fans speculate on songs that hint at her interaction with Travis Kelce and personal acquaintances. From "Father Figure" allegedly addressing music executive Scott Borchetta to rumors surrounding "Cancelled!" touching on her friendship with Blake Lively, the album keeps listeners hooked in a seemingly endless cycle of analysis.
